openssh是什么
时间: 2024-03-27 16:33:59 浏览: 143
OpenSSH是一个用于安全远程登录和文件传输的开源软件套件。它提供了加密的通信通道,使得用户可以在不安全的网络上安全地远程登录到远程服务器或主机,并进行文件传输。OpenSSH使用SSH(Secure Shell)协议来加密通信,确保数据的机密性和完整性。
OpenSSH具有以下主要功能:
1. 远程登录:通过OpenSSH,用户可以在本地计算机上使用SSH客户端远程登录到远程服务器或主机,以执行命令和管理远程系统。
2. 文件传输:OpenSSH支持安全的文件传输功能,可以通过SCP(Secure Copy)或SFTP(SSH File Transfer Protocol)协议在本地计算机和远程服务器之间传输文件。
3. 端口转发:OpenSSH提供了端口转发功能,可以将本地计算机上的网络流量通过加密通道转发到远程服务器,实现安全的网络连接。
相关问题
openssh 是什么
<<
OpenSSH (Open Source Secure Shell) 是一个开源的安全协议套件,用于提供远程登录(Telnet)和加密文件传输(SFTP、SCP)服务。它的主要组件是 SSH(Secure Shell),它提供了一种安全的方式来在计算机之间进行命令行通信,特别是在互联网上,因为它使用公钥加密技术保证了数据的安全性和身份验证。
OpenSSH 包括客户端软件,可以连接到支持 SSH 协议的服务器;以及服务器端软件,可以在本地主机或远程服务器上运行并监听连接请求。它是许多Linux发行版和许多其他系统默认使用的SSH工具,广泛应用于系统管理、运维、DevOps等领域。
Linux openssh是什么
Linux OpenSSH(Open Secure Shell)是一个开源的、安全的远程登录协议和服务集,它基于SSH(Secure Shell)标准,允许用户在Unix或类Unix系统之间安全地传输数据和执行命令。SSH提供了一种加密通道,使得用户可以在不直接暴露网络连接的情况下进行远程登录,管理服务器,传输文件,以及进行其他需要验证身份的安全操作。
OpenSSH包含客户端软件(sshd)用于提供服务,以及一个守护进程sshd,它监听网络连接并处理相应的请求。服务器端通常安装在Linux服务器上,而客户端则可以在各种操作系统中找到,包括Linux、macOS和Windows等。
OpenSSH的主要功能包括:
1. 安全登录:使用公钥加密来验证用户身份,保护登录信息不被窃听。
2. 文件传输:支持SFTP(Secure File Transfer Protocol)和SCP(Secure Copy Protocol)进行安全的文件上传和下载。
3. 防火墙友好:通过TCP隧道,即使在防火墙内也能实现远程访问。
4. 兼容性:与其他SSH服务器和客户端兼容,方便跨平台通信。
阅读全文